| #include "lldb/API/SBAddressRange.h" |
| #include "Utils.h" |
| #include "lldb/API/SBAddress.h" |
| #include "lldb/API/SBStream.h" |
| #include "lldb/API/SBTarget.h" |
| #include "lldb/Core/AddressRange.h" |
| #include "lldb/Core/Section.h" |
| #include "lldb/Utility/Instrumentation.h" |
| #include "lldb/Utility/Stream.h" |
| #include <cstddef> |
| #include <memory> |
| |
| using namespace lldb; |
| using namespace lldb_private; |
| |
| SBAddressRange::SBAddressRange() |
| : m_opaque_up(std::make_unique<AddressRange>()) { |
| LLDB_INSTRUMENT_VA(this); |
| } |
| |
| SBAddressRange::SBAddressRange(const SBAddressRange &rhs) { |
| LLDB_INSTRUMENT_VA(this, rhs); |
| |
| m_opaque_up = clone(rhs.m_opaque_up); |
| } |
| |
| SBAddressRange::SBAddressRange(lldb::SBAddress addr, lldb::addr_t byte_size) |
| : m_opaque_up(std::make_unique<AddressRange>(addr.ref(), byte_size)) { |
| LLDB_INSTRUMENT_VA(this, addr, byte_size); |
| } |
| |
| SBAddressRange::~SBAddressRange() = default; |
| |
| const SBAddressRange &SBAddressRange::operator=(const SBAddressRange &rhs) { |
| LLDB_INSTRUMENT_VA(this, rhs); |
| |
| if (this != &rhs) |
| m_opaque_up = clone(rhs.m_opaque_up); |
| return *this; |
| } |
| |
| bool SBAddressRange::operator==(const SBAddressRange &rhs) { |
| LLDB_INSTRUMENT_VA(this, rhs); |
| |
| return ref().operator==(rhs.ref()); |
| } |
| |
| bool SBAddressRange::operator!=(const SBAddressRange &rhs) { |
| LLDB_INSTRUMENT_VA(this, rhs); |
| |
| return !(*this == rhs); |
| } |
| |
| void SBAddressRange::Clear() { |
| LLDB_INSTRUMENT_VA(this); |
| |
| ref().Clear(); |
| } |
| |
| bool SBAddressRange::IsValid() const { |
| LLDB_INSTRUMENT_VA(this); |
| |
| return ref().IsValid(); |
| } |
| |
| lldb::SBAddress SBAddressRange::GetBaseAddress() const { |
| LLDB_INSTRUMENT_VA(this); |
| |
| return lldb::SBAddress(ref().GetBaseAddress()); |
| } |
| |
| lldb::addr_t SBAddressRange::GetByteSize() const { |
| LLDB_INSTRUMENT_VA(this); |
| |
| return ref().GetByteSize(); |
| } |
| |
| bool SBAddressRange::GetDescription(SBStream &description, |
| const SBTarget target) { |
| LLDB_INSTRUMENT_VA(this, description, target); |
| |
| return ref().GetDescription(&description.ref(), target.GetSP().get()); |
| } |
| |
| lldb_private::AddressRange &SBAddressRange::ref() const { |
| assert(m_opaque_up && "opaque pointer must always be valid"); |
| return *m_opaque_up; |
| } |
